Lets compare vitamin content per 300 calories of Canned Red Kidney Beans with Liquids vs Cereals ready-to-eat, QUAKER, QUAKER Puffed Wheat:
300 calories of Canned Red Kidney Beans with Liquids have 2.8 times more Vitamin B6 and 9.3 times more Vitamin K than Cereals ready-to-eat, QUAKER, QUAKER Puffed Wheat.
While 300 kcal of Cereals ready-to-eat, QUAKER, QUAKER Puffed Wheat contain 1.3 times more Vitamin B1, 1.3 times more Vitamin B2, 2.4 times more Vitamin B3, 1.5 times more Vitamin B9 and more Vitamin B12 than Canned Red Kidney Beans Solids and Liquids.
300 calories of Canned Red Kidney Beans with Liquids have insufficient amounts of Vitamin B12
300 calories of Cereals ready-to-eat, QUAKER, QUAKER Puffed Wheat have insufficient amounts of Vitamin K
Both Canned Red Kidney Beans Solids and Liquids as well as Cereals ready-to-eat, QUAKER, QUAKER Puffed Wheat have insufficient amounts of Vitamin A, Vitamin C, Vitamin D and Vitamin E in 300 calories.
Comparing minerals per 300 calories for Canned Red Kidney Beans with Liquids vs Cereals ready-to-eat, QUAKER, QUAKER Puffed Wheat:
300 calories of Canned Red Kidney Beans with Liquids have 5.5 times more Calcium, 1.5 times more Copper, 1.3 times more Iron, 1.4 times more Phosphorus, 3.2 times more Potassium, 231.3 times more Sodium and 95.5 times more Water than Cereals ready-to-eat, QUAKER, QUAKER Puffed Wheat.
While 300 kcal of Cereals ready-to-eat, QUAKER, QUAKER Puffed Wheat contain 24.8 times more Selenium than Canned Red Kidney Beans Solids and Liquids.
Both Canned Red Kidney Beans with Liquids and Cereals ready-to-eat, QUAKER, QUAKER Puffed Wheat contain similar levels of Magnesium and Zinc per 300 calories.
300 calories of Cereals ready-to-eat, QUAKER, QUAKER Puffed Wheat lack sufficient amounts of Calcium
Comparison of macro-nutrients per 300 calories:
300 calories of Canned Red Kidney Beans with Liquids have 5.8 times more Omega 3, 6.1 times more Sugars, 2.1 times more Fiber and 1.5 times more Protein than Cereals ready-to-eat, QUAKER, QUAKER Puffed Wheat.
Both Canned Red Kidney Beans with Liquids and Cereals ready-to-eat, QUAKER, QUAKER Puffed Wheat offer comparable quantities of Energy and Carbohydrate per 300 calories.
300 calories of Cereals ready-to-eat, QUAKER, QUAKER Puffed Wheat provide inadequate amounts of Omega 3
Both Canned Red Kidney Beans Solids and Liquids as well as Cereals ready-to-eat, QUAKER, QUAKER Puffed Wheat provide inadequate amounts of Omega 6 in 300 calories.
